A home server is a dedicated computer system within a residence that provides data, media, or application services to other devices on the home network. Unlike a standard desktop PC, a home server is designed for 24/7 operation, low power consumption, and quiet, reliable performance. It acts as a central hub for managing digital life, offering significant advantages in organization, accessibility, and security for personal data.

Key Specifications for a Home Server

The ideal home server balances performance with efficiency. Key components include:

  • Processor: Modern, low-power CPUs like Intel's N-series (e.g., N100) or Celeron series are excellent for handling file serving, media transcoding, and running lightweight applications without excessive heat or power draw.

  • Memory (RAM): 8GB to 16GB of RAM is typically sufficient for most home server tasks, allowing smooth operation of the server operating system and several concurrent services.

  • Storage: This is critical. Servers require ample, reliable storage. Look for systems with multiple SATA or M.2 slots to accommodate large hard drives (HDDs) for bulk storage and solid-state drives (SSDs) for the operating system and frequently accessed files.

  • Connectivity: Multiple Gigabit Ethernet ports are essential for fast network transfers and link aggregation. USB 3.2 ports are useful for connecting external backup drives or peripherals.

  • Form Factor: A compact, fanless Mini PC is often the perfect choice for a home server due to its small size, silent operation, and energy efficiency, making it easy to place in a living room or closet.

Common Home Server Use Cases

Home servers are versatile and can be configured for numerous applications:

  • Network-Attached Storage (NAS): Centralize photos, videos, documents, and backups for access from any device.

  • Media Server: Use software like Plex, Jellyfin, or Emby to stream your personal movie and music library to smart TVs, phones, and tablets.

  • Home Automation Hub: Host platforms like Home Assistant to control smart lights, thermostats, and security cameras.

  • Personal Cloud/File Sync: Create your own private cloud storage (e.g., using Nextcloud) to replace commercial services.

  • Game Server: Host private servers for multiplayer games like Minecraft or Valheim for you and your friends.
